    Neftaly: How Adaptive Skiing Works for Paralympians

    Adaptive skiing enables athletes with disabilities to participate in alpine and Nordic skiing, utilizing specialized equipment and techniques tailored to their specific needs.


    ????️ Adaptive Skiing Equipment

    • Sit Skis (Mono Skis): Designed for athletes with lower limb disabilities, sit skis feature a bucket-style seat mounted on a single ski. Athletes steer using handheld outriggers or poles. Advanced models, like the Tessier Scarver, offer adjustable suspension systems and can convert between mono and dual skis for versatility in different terrains.     • Bi-Skis: These are similar to sit skis but have two skis underneath the seat, providing added stability. They are suitable for beginners and can be used independently or with assistance. Oregon Adaptive Sports
    • Outriggers and Poles: For standing skiers, adaptive ski poles with outriggers offer additional balance and control. These are often used by athletes with amputations or other mobility impairments. WIRED+1
    • Adaptive Wheelchair Ski Attachments: Devices like track systems can be added to wheelchairs, allowing users to navigate snow-covered terrain. These attachments are customizable and battery-powered for ease of movement. challengedathletes.org+1

    ????️ Training and Classification

    Adaptive skiing training is tailored to the athlete’s abilities and equipment. Athletes are classified into three main categories:

    • Sitting Skiers: Use sit skis and compete in events like slalom and downhill.moove.store+2cxcskiing.org+2
    • Standing Skiers: Use outriggers and poles, competing in various alpine events.WIRED
    • Visually Impaired Skiers: Navigate with the assistance of guides and specialized equipment.

    Training programs focus on building strength, technique, and confidence, often incorporating indoor sessions on rollerski treadmills and strength training. cxcskiing.org

    Youth hockey development is a structured process designed to cultivate skills, sportsmanship, and passion for the game from an early age. By combining coaching, training, competition, and mentorship, youth programs lay the foundation for future professional and recreational players.

    Grassroots and Entry-Level Programs
    Children typically start in beginner programs focused on skating, puck handling, and basic rules. Emphasis is placed on fun, safety, and building confidence on the ice. Learn-to-play initiatives encourage participation regardless of prior experience.

    Skill Development and Coaching
    As players progress, structured coaching focuses on advanced skills: passing, shooting, positioning, and tactical awareness. Professional coaches and certified trainers provide guidance tailored to age and ability, fostering both individual growth and team play.

    Competitive Leagues and Tournaments
    Youth leagues and tournaments introduce players to structured competition. These experiences teach discipline, teamwork, and sportsmanship, while providing opportunities for scouting and advancement to higher levels of play.

    Physical Conditioning
    Strength, agility, endurance, and flexibility training are integrated into youth programs to support athletic development. Proper conditioning helps prevent injuries and builds the physical foundation necessary for competitive hockey.

    Mental and Emotional Growth
    Youth hockey emphasizes resilience, focus, and confidence. Players learn to handle wins, losses, and challenges, developing the mental toughness required for long-term success both on and off the ice.

    Pathways to Elite and Professional Levels
    Top performers may advance to junior leagues, academies, and national development programs. Exposure to higher competition levels, specialized coaching, and performance analytics helps prepare athletes for potential professional careers.

    Community and Mentorship
    Youth programs often involve mentorship from older players, volunteers, and alumni. Community support fosters engagement, teaches values, and strengthens the culture of hockey.

    In summary, youth hockey development combines skill training, competition, physical conditioning, and personal growth. By nurturing talent and character from an early age, these programs ensure the continued success and vitality of hockey at all levels.

    Neftaly: How Carbohydrate Loading Works in Endurance Sports

    Carbohydrate loading is a strategy used by endurance athletes to maximize muscle glycogen stores before prolonged events.

    1. Glycogen as Fuel

    Muscles store carbohydrates as glycogen, the primary energy source during extended, high-intensity exercise.

    2. Loading Phase

    By increasing carbohydrate intake 3-4 days before competition—while tapering training—athletes boost glycogen levels beyond normal.

    3. Benefits During Performance

    Higher glycogen stores delay fatigue, improve endurance, and help maintain intensity throughout the event.

    4. Types of Carbohydrates

    Complex carbs like pasta, rice, and oats provide sustained energy, while simple carbs can be used closer to competition for quick fuel.

    5. Individual Variation

    Optimal carb loading depends on the athlete’s body, sport, and event length, requiring personalized plans.

    Neftaly: How Periodization Works in Athlete Training

    Periodization is a systematic approach to organizing training into phases to optimize performance and recovery.

    1. Phases of Periodization

    • Preparation Phase: Focuses on building a fitness base with higher volume and lower intensity.
    • Competition Phase: Emphasizes peak performance with higher intensity and reduced volume.
    • Transition Phase: A recovery period with low intensity and volume to allow physical and mental restoration.

    2. Types of Periodization

    • Linear: Gradually increases intensity while decreasing volume over time.
    • Non-linear (Undulating): Varies intensity and volume frequently to target multiple fitness components.
    • Block: Focuses on specific skills or qualities in concentrated blocks.

    3. Benefits

    Periodization helps prevent plateaus, reduces injury risk, manages fatigue, and promotes peak performance during key competitions.

    4. Customization

    Training plans are tailored to the athlete’s sport, season goals, and individual response to training loads.

    5. Monitoring and Adjustment

    Regular assessment allows coaches to modify periodization plans based on progress and recovery status.
